Keonjhar: Two Youths Drown at Patahara Waterfall While Taking Photos

A serene Sunday outing ended in sorrow when two youths tragically lost their lives after falling into a water body in the picturesque Patahara Waterfall area of Harichandanpur Block in Keonjhar District.


The victims, identified as Atul Ranjan Sahu and Rudranarayan Mishra, both 20 years old from Jagatsinghpur District, were part of a group of four friends working at the Tata plant in Duburi, Jajpur. They had ventured to the natural splendour of Chandangiri Hills and Patahara caves to enjoy the holiday. While exploring the scenic area and taking photographs, a misstep led to the fatal incident.

During their photo session near the water stream, the two youths accidentally slipped and fell into the water. Their inability to swim proved costly, as they couldn’t escape the depths.

Despite efforts by locals and rescue teams, their lifeless bodies were recovered after a 20-minute operation led by fire brigade personnel.

The families of the deceased rushed to the scene as news of the tragedy spread. Two surviving friends of the group were left speechless, unable to recount the incident due to the shock.

The tragedy has sparked conversations about the importance of learning life-saving skills like swimming and taking precautions in natural tourist spots to prevent such heartbreaking occurrences.
